If I'm taking HRT, is it likely I wouldn't need Vagifem? I've been experiencing some issues and didn't even think about VA as I'm on HRT, but the specialist today said to me it could still be useful. Is it generally common to take both Vagifem and HRT? Sorry if that's a really silly question!

It is not uncommon for those using systemic HRT to need local oestrogen as well, as systemic does not always reach the genitourinary tract. I would accept the Vagifem and start asap, before things get any worse.
